How did the heliocentric theory of universe differ from the geocentric theory?

the heliocentric theory is the theory that the sun is in the center of the universe. the geocentric theory is the theory that the earth is in the center of the universeGeocentric models had the earth as the center of the universe with the sun and all the planets orbiting it. Heliocentric models (the current accepted ones) have the sun as the center, with the earth and planets orbiting it.Geocentric was the idea developed by the Greek philosopher Aristotle of an earth-centered view of the solar system. What word describes the theory that the universe is centered around the earth it sounded like my teacher said talemaic?

Geocentrism. The word was probably "Ptolemaic" science, as in Claudius Ptolemy.

Who was Copernicus and what was the heliocentric?

He was a Polish mathematician who disagreed with Ptolemy's view that the earth is the center of the universe. The heliocentric theory is the theory that the sun is the center of the universe, not the earth.
